Martha lives in Westport, a short drive but very different from Norwalk...<BR><BR>SoNo area has the Maritime Center, a small charming historical society with fun "antique/thrift" shop (no clothes), upscale shops and a few outlet shops a few blocks away (outlet center for Exposures, catalog of fine picture frames and albums)and a few nice restaurants including a good brewpub, The Brewhouse.<BR><BR>Also, to see in Norwalk, (not SoNo area)<BR>Lockwood Matthews mansion, and Stew Leonards (enormous grocery/dairy with fun dispalys and things to do with kids (it's very famous in the region)

There's also an IMAX movie theater, which I believe is at the Maritime Center previously mentioned. If you've never been, it'a a giant dome screen (horizontally and vertically) and you feel like you're IN the scenery being shown. Really fun.

There are lots of restuarants, bars and nightlife in SONO. The Brewpub soesn't have very good food. Some of my favorites are Barcelona which serves great paella, really good tapas and has an extensive wine list by the glass. Habana is also a great place with a Cuban theme, lots of rum drinks, different and delicious food. Ocean drive is THE scene, especially on a Friday night, lots of good looking singles, a raw bar, seafood.<BR><BR>The loft is a good bar, lous, not live music, young crowd. Velvet is a dance club across the street from Loft, doesn't get going to late at night. <BR><BR>If your looking for nightlife, head to Sono. I assume you're here on business.
